28/* Maximum length of an instruction. */
29#define MAXLEN 8
30
31#include <setjmp.h>
32
33static int fetch_data PARAMS ((struct disassemble_info *, bfd_byte *));
34
35struct private
36{
37 /* Points to first byte not fetched. */
38 bfd_byte *max_fetched;
39 bfd_byte the_buffer[MAXLEN];
40 bfd_vma insn_start;
41 jmp_buf bailout;
42};
43
44/* Make sure that bytes from INFO->PRIVATE_DATA->BUFFER (inclusive)
45 to ADDR (exclusive) are valid. Returns 1 for success, longjmps
46 on error. */
47#define FETCH_DATA(info, addr) \
48 ((addr) <= ((struct private *)(info->private_data))->max_fetched \
49 ? 1 : fetch_data ((info), (addr)))
50
51static int
52fetch_data (info, addr)
53 struct disassemble_info *info;
54 bfd_byte *addr;
55{
56 int status;
57 struct private *priv = (struct private *) info->private_data;
58 bfd_vma start = priv->insn_start + (priv->max_fetched - priv->the_buffer);
59
60 status = (*info->read_memory_func) (start,
61 priv->max_fetched,
62 addr - priv->max_fetched,
63 info);
64 if (status != 0)
65 {
66 (*info->memory_error_func) (status, start, info);
67 longjmp (priv->bailout, 1);
68 }
69 else
70 priv->max_fetched = addr;
71 return 1;
72}
